What Is Semaglutide?

Semaglutide is a GLP-1 receptor agonist, meaning it mimics the action of the naturally occurring hormone glucagon-like peptide-1.

Originally studied for type 2 diabetes, Semaglutide is now one of the most researched compounds for:

  • appetite regulation

  • body weight reduction

  • metabolic optimization

  • digestion speed

  • glucose control

How Semaglutide Works — Mechanism Explained Simply

To understand Semaglutide, you need to understand the role of GLP-1.

GLP-1 controls:

  • appetite

  • stomach emptying

  • insulin release

  • blood sugar stability

  • satiety (fullness sensation)

Semaglutide mimics this hormone but with longer-lasting activity, allowing researchers to investigate these pathways more deeply.


1. Appetite Suppression

Semaglutide reduces appetite by acting on appetite-control centers in the brain.

Effects observed include:

  • fewer cravings

  • reduced hunger

  • lowered caloric intake

  • less desire for high-calorie foods

This is one reason Semaglutide has become a dominant peptide for obesity-related research.


2. Slowed Digestion (Gastric Emptying Delay)

This mechanism means:

✔ Food stays in the stomach longer

✔ Subjects feel full for extended periods

✔ Hunger signals decline

Semaglutide’s digestion-slowing effect is one of the strongest in the GLP-1 class.


3. Improved Insulin Signaling

Research shows Semaglutide can support:

  • better insulin sensitivity

  • improved glucose control

  • more stable blood sugar levels

This is why it was originally studied in diabetes models.


4. Caloric Reduction → Weight Reduction

When appetite decreases AND food stays longer in the stomach…

total calorie intake drops significantly

Most metabolic studies highlight this mechanism as the primary driver of weight reduction.

Side Effects of Semaglutide Observed in Research Models

Just like any research compound, Semaglutide has reported side effects in experimental environments.

semaglutide benefits and side effects

The most commonly observed include:


1. Nausea

The #1 reported side effect.

2. Reduced Appetite (Sometimes Excessively)

Some research subjects show:

  • extremely low appetite

  • skipping meals

  • extended fasting-like behavior

This is part of its mechanism but must be monitored.


3. Slowed Gastric Emptying

This can cause:

  • fullness

  • bloating

  • delayed digestion

  • early satiety

This is considered a mechanism, not a “problem,” but it contributes to discomfort in some studies.


4. Fatigue or Low Energy

Because of reduced food intake.


5. Mild Gastrointestinal Issues

Reported in some studies:

  • constipation

  • diarrhea

  • stomach discomfort

Semaglutide vs Tirzepatide — Which Is Stronger?

Tirzepatide

activates two receptors:

  • GLP-1 (like Semaglutide)

  • GIP

Research shows:

  • stronger appetite reduction

  • faster weight reductions

  • more efficient energy use

Summary:

  • Semaglutide = strong appetite peptide

  • Tirzepatide = strongest dual-pathway metabolic peptide
